The Beatles take us through the ordinary day of a handy man. “Fixing a hole where the rain gets in . . . . filling the cracks that run through the door . . . . painting [his] room in a colorful way.” Every employer needs someone to do little things that, all told, amount to big things or, as the song goes, “Things that weren’t important yesterday.” He’s right where he belongs as opposed to all the silly people running around.
